How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wydown?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Wydown Studio Apartments | $1,450 | $825 | $1,805 |
Wydown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,862 | $865 | $3,201 |
Wydown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,000 | $1,250 | $4,180 |
Wydown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,690 | $1,250 | $3,595 |
Wydown 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,700 | $3,700 | $3,700 |
